Miranda’s departure shattered our family. She left me, Charlie, and our two young daughters, Sophie and Emily, for a life of luxury with a wealthy man. Her sudden exit left us reeling, especially as Sophie, at five, and Emily, at four, couldn’t understand why their mother was gone.

Over the next two years, I focused on rebuilding our lives. We established new routines—pancake Saturdays, dance-offs in the living room, and quiet bedtime stories. These moments became our normal, and the ache Miranda left behind dulled into a manageable scar.

Then, one Wednesday, life threw me a curveball. While shopping for groceries, I spotted Miranda. She looked nothing like the vibrant woman from Instagram. Her hair was dull, her clothes wrinkled, her face hollow. For a moment, I thought I was mistaken. But when I called out her name, her head snapped up. Her eyes widened in recognition before she turned and bolted.

That night, I sent a text to her old number. To my surprise, she responded, agreeing to meet the next day. When I saw her sitting on a park bench, hunched and fidgeting, it was clear life had not been kind.

“What happened to you, Miranda?” I asked, sitting down. “Where’s Marco? The yachts? The perfect life you left us for?”

Her voice cracked as she began to cry. “It was all a lie. Marco wasn’t some wealthy businessman—he was a con artist. He drained my savings, spent my inheritance, and disappeared when the money ran out. I’m broke, Charlie. I have nothing.”

I stared at her, stunned. “You destroyed your family for that?”

She nodded, tears streaming. “I was wrong. I see that now. I’ve lost everything. I just want to fix this… to be a mom to Sophie and Emily again.”

Her words hung in the air, heavy with desperation. I thought about the nights I spent rocking our daughters to sleep, the countless questions they asked about their absent mother. She had walked away when we needed her most, and now she wanted to waltz back in?

“No,” I said firmly. “You made your choice, Miranda. The girls and I have moved on, and we’re happy without you. They deserve stability, love, and someone who won’t abandon them.”

Her face crumbled, but I felt no pity. “I hope you figure out your life, but you won’t do it at our expense,” I added before walking away.

When I got home, Sophie and Emily greeted me with their usual excitement. That night, as we made pancakes topped with too many sprinkles, I realized how far we’d come. Miranda’s choices had brought her to ruin, but they had also shown me the strength of the family she left behind.

“Daddy, these are the best pancakes ever!” Sophie exclaimed, syrup dripping from her chin.

I smiled, ruffling her hair. “I think so too, sweetheart.”

In the end, Miranda chased what she thought was happiness. But she never knew what real joy looked like. I did. And for that, I was grateful.
